Variants in transcription factor GLI2 have been associated with hypopituitarism and structural brain abnormalities, occasionally including holoprosencephaly (HPE). Substantial phenotypic variability and nonpenetrance have been described, posing difficulties in the counseling of affected families. We present three individuals with novel likely pathogenic GLI2 variants, two with truncating and one with a de novo missense variant p.(Ser548Leu), and review the literature for comprehensive phenotypic descriptions of individuals with confirmed pathogenic (a) intragenic GLI2 variants and (b) chromosome 2q14.2 deletions encompassing only GLI2. We show that most of the 31 missense variants previously reported as pathogenic are likely benign or, at most, low-risk variants. Four Zn-finger variants: p.(Arg479Gly), p.(Arg516Pro), p.(Gly518Lys), and p.(Tyr575His) were classified as likely pathogenic, and three other variants as possibly pathogenic: p.(Pro253Ser), p.(Ala593Val), and p.(Pro1243Leu). We analyze the phenotypic descriptions of 60 individuals with pathogenic GLI2 variants and evidence a morbidity spectrum that includes hypopituitarism (58%), HPE (6%) or other brain structure abnormalities (15%), orofacial clefting (17%) and dysmorphic facial features (35%). We establish that truncating and Zn-finger variants in GLI2 are associated with a high risk of hypopituitarism, and that a solitary median maxillary central incisor is part of the GLI2-related phenotypic variability. The most prevalent phenotypic feature is post-axial polydactyly (65%) which is also the mildest phenotypic expression of the condition, reported in many parents of individuals with systemic findings. Our approach clarifies clinical risks and the important messages to discuss in counseling for a pathogenic GLI2 variant.

OBJECTIVES: Tonsillectomy (TE) or adenotonsillectomy (ATE) may have a beneficial effect on the clinical course in children with the periodic fever, aphthous stomatitis, pharyngitis and cervical adenitis (PFAPA) syndrome. However, an immunological reason for this effect remains unknown. This literature review summarizes the current knowledge regarding the immunological role of the tonsils in the PFAPA syndrome. METHODS: We searched PubMed, Medline, EMBASE and Cochrane for papers written in English dated from 1 January 1987 to 30 April 2019. The search included all studies reporting histological, immunological or microbiological workup of tonsil specimens from children aged 0-18 years with PFAPA. RESULTS: Thirteen articles reported histological, immunological or microbiological workup of tonsil specimens in children with PFAPA. The histology of tonsil specimens from children with PFAPA displayed chronic tonsillar inflammation with lymphoid hyperplasia. No uniform immunological pattern was identified, but some studies found fewer B-lymphocytes and smaller germinal centers in PFAPA compared to controls. A difference in tonsillar microbiota between PFAPA and controls was found in one study. CONCLUSION: A uniform immunological or microbiological pattern explaining the clinical effect of TE in children with PFAPA has not been revealed. Future targeted immunological studies of tonsils in PFAPA patients could possibly illuminate the understanding of the immunology in this disease.

BACKGROUND: Tonsillectomy (TE) or adenotonsillectomy (ATE) may have a beneficial effect on the clinical course in children with the Periodic Fever, Aphthous stomatitis, Pharyngitis and cervical Adenitis (PFAPA) syndrome. However, an immunological reason for this effect remains unknown. This literature review summarizes the current knowledge of the effect of TE or ATE in the PFAPA syndrome. METHODS: A search of PubMed, Medline, EMBASE and Cochrane was conducted for papers written in English dated from 1 January 1987 to 31 December 2016. The search included all studies reporting outcomes after TE or ATE from children aged 0 to 18 years with PFAPA. RESULTS: Two randomized controlled trials reported significantly faster resolution of febrile episodes after TE or ATE in children with PFAPA compared to controls (non-surgery groups). We identified 28 case series including 555 children with PFAPA. The diagnosis was set prospectively before surgery in 440 children and retrospectively after surgery in 115 of the children. TE or ATE had a curative effect in 509 of the 555 children with PFAPA (92%), but few studies were of high quality. CONCLUSION: TE or ATE may have a curative effect on children with PFAPA, but the evidence is of moderate quality. Further high-quality randomized controlled studies are still needed.

BACKGROUND: The Periodic Fever, Aphthous stomatitis, Pharyngitis and cervical Adenitis syndrome (PFAPA) is the most common periodic fever syndrome in childhood. Clinically, PFAPA may resemble autoinflammatory diseases, but the etiology is not fully understood. METHODS: We measured inflammatory proteins in plasma and hematologic parameters in children with PFAPA during and between febrile episodes, and in a control group with suspected bacterial pneumonia. In children with PFAPA, a first blood sample was taken within 24 hours of a febrile episode and a second sample between episodes. In children with pneumonia, the first sample was taken shortly after admission and a second sample after full recovery. RESULTS: A total of 22 children with PFAPA and 14 children with pneumonia were included. In children with PFAPA, levels of interleukin (IL) 6, CXCL10 and CCL4 were significantly increased during febrile episodes. The levels of IL-6 and CXCL10 were higher in children with PFAPA during febrile episodes than in children with pneumonia. The levels of CXCL10 remained higher in children with PFAPA between febrile episodes compared to children with pneumonia after recovery. Children with PFAPA had a relative eosinopenia and lymphocytopenia with reduced numbers of both CD4+ and CD8+ T cells during febrile episodes. This pattern was not observed in the children with pneumonia. CONCLUSIONS: The results indicate an innate immune response as the initial step in PFAPA, and a subsequent adaptive response with activation and redistribution of T cells. Moreover, an activation of the innate immune system involving CXCL10 may persist between febrile episodes. CXCL10 may be a possibly clinical marker in children with PFAPA.

AIM: To describe the incidence, epidemiology, clinical presentation and clinical outcome of children with the syndrome of periodic fever, aphthous stomatitis, pharyngitis and cervical adenitis (PFAPA) in a population-based study. METHODS: In a prospective population-based study, all children in South Rogaland, Norway, diagnosed with PFAPA during 2004-2010 were evaluated clinically, and parents were interviewed systematically. A follow-up interview was performed for all patients. RESULTS: A total of 46 children (32 boys; p = 0.011) were diagnosed with PFAPA. We calculated an incidence of 2.3 per 10 000 children up to 5 years of age. The median age of onset was 11.0 months (quartiles: 5.0, 14.8). Nearly 37 children were followed until resolution. In 17 of these, a tonsillectomy was performed with prompt resolution of PFAPA in all. The median age of spontaneous resolution was 60.2 months (range 24-120) and in children with tonsillectomy 50.9 months (range 15-128). CONCLUSION: The incidence of PFAPA was 2.3 per 10 000 children up to 5 years of age. In the majority of cases, onset of symptoms may be during the first year of life.

AIMS: To evaluate levels of C-reactive protein (CRP) during febrile episodes in children with periodic fever, aphthous stomatitis, pharyngitis and cervical adenitis syndrome (PFAPA). METHODS: All CRP values during typical episodes of fever in children diagnosed with PFAPA during a 3 years period were retrospectively registered. RESULTS: In 16 children with PFAPA, a total of 87 CRP values were registered during 38 episodes of fever. The mean of the maximum CRP during each episode was 185 mg/L (SD: 69.4, range: 45-322). Values of CRP were elevated throughout the whole period of fever, with higher values on days 2-4 compared to day 1. CONCLUSION: Levels of CRP are substantially increased during febrile episodes in children with PFAPA. High levels of CRP may suggest a role for immunological mechanisms in PFAPA, and may raise the suspicion of PFAPA when measured in children with periodic fever of unknown origin.
